Synopsis

Welsh soprano Katherine Jenkins performs live at Margam Park, Swansea. Features 20 tracks interspersed with interviews with the singer. Songs include 'Amazing Grace', 'Yr Arglwydd A Fendithied', and 'La Donne E Mobile'.

This is wonderful. As soon as I had my evening meal, I had to sit down and watch this lovely DVD right through, after all I think Katherine Jenkins has a lovely voice, and er, yes she is quite a stunner too with a very open and natural personality.

Recorded at Margam Park, near Swansea on a lovely summers evening only a few months ago, this is a music festival designed to be enjoyed by everyone who was there that night. Amongst the numerous tracks are

Music of The Night (Phantom of The Opera)
I Will Always Love You (The Bodyguard)
Nella Fantasia (The Mission) *This brought tears to my eyes, its an amazing piece, superbly sung by Katherine
Requiem For A Soldier (Band of Brothers)

and numerous pieces of pure Welsh Music with the audience joining in a couple of tracks which isnt surprising.

There is also a guest Tenor, Juan Dego Florez who sings Granada superbly and also joins in with Katherine in a duet Non Ti Scordar Di Me.

I cannot praise this DVD too highly. For those viewers who for some reason, do not think much to it, maybe the music isnt to their taste, or perhaps they have a hard heart. But for Katherine fans, and genuine music lovers they will love this I am sure.

There is also an added bonus of three further tracks recorded elsewhere with Mozart's Classic Laudate Dominum being the highlight of the three.

Picture quality is very good indeed. And for a further bonus, if you have a Home Cinema Amplifier capable of reproducing DTS 5:1 as well as Dolby Digital 5:1, then you are in for a treat, for the sound is excellent. If your system does not have DTS, then perhaps you should think about upgrading your sound system; after all, more and more DVDs are being released with this sound format these days.

A Great Buy.

A beautiful performance, but (in my opinion and based on results from my DVD player) the picture quality is not as good as the original TV transmission, and lacks clarity. Perhaps this is because the DVD has been issued in NTSC format instead of PAL. The performance was recorded in the UK (Margam Park in Wales) so why use NTSC when our own PAL system could have produced better quality pictures? Perhaps the producers could issue a second edition in PAL!

I first heard and saw Katherine Jenkins on TV here in South Africa where they had a few minutes interview with her and some sound bites from several of her songs. Immediately I heard her voice, I must confess I melted inside! There is something about not only her looks, but her voice that sets her apart from the ordinary.

My first reaction when I played Katherine in the Park and Universal's blurred and fuzzy logo came on the screen was to wonder if I was wearing my reading glasses." I have many Universal DVDs but this is the worst one by far. The technical quality of the rest of the DVD is nothing to shout about either and I would have thought that more care would have been put into making this production. Katherine Jenkins has perhaps the richest, fullest and most beautiful Mezzo-soprano voice I have ever heard, and to produce such a poor quality product as this, is almost an insult to her. I normally watch my DVDs using a 1280 x 720 pixel native widescreen projector so if a DVD is of poor quality it is immediately noticeable, but even when played on my TV, the quality is noticeably below par. If it hadn't been for the poor technical quality I would have given this DVD 5 stars plus!

For me, one of the best parts of the DVD are the four extras: Ave Maria; Laudate Dominum; Calon Lan and Nella Fantasia, all of them studio productions. Once again the picture quality goes from fair to abysmal with the sound quality also varying. My favourite is Nella Fantasia and it's in this piece that her voice can be heard at its best. Unfortunately the sound engineers had the orchestral backing so loud at times that her voice was almost drowned out in places. Her voice has such a wonderful quality that I think another reviewer of her CDs summed it up by saying that her voice has a "presence" to it that he'd heard in only one other soprano! My other favourite in the extras is Laudate Dominum. The picture quality of this track is the worst on the DVD - but her voice is SO rich and lovely! I then played another DVD I have of Rachel Harnisch singing the same piece. To be fair to Rachel, she is not a Mezzo, but even so, Katherine's rendering is fuller and richer and "light years" better than Rachel's imo.

Outdoor performances are usually problematic with the accoustics being poor to non-existant, but even so, her two duets (Only Make Believe and Non ti Scordar di me) with the tenor, Juan Diego Florez, were outstanding as were the two pieces he sang solo. The impression I got from this DVD is that Katherine's voice is more suited to classical and semi-classical works and that for her to sing the more "popular" pieces does not do justice to her voice. Two works come to mind where her mezzo-soprano would be well suited; Mozart's Requiem and Handel's Messiah. My hope and prayer is that Universal will allow her the freedom to do this type of work and not to push her harder into the pop market where they can make a quick buck from her talents before dropping her.
